About the Job:
Red Hat South East Asia TAM team is looking for an experienced, enterprise-level engineer to join us as a Technical Account Manager. In this role, you will serve as a trusted advisor who will work with a small set of key strategic customers to provide practical technical and architectural guidance for the Red Hat Enterprise Linux / OpenShift Container Platform. You will provide personalized, attentive, proactive support and mentorship to assigned strategic enterprise customers. You will establish high-value relationships with key stakeholders to understand their environment, including IT infrastructure, internal processes, and business requirements. You will share technical best practices and serve as a point of contact for any major incidents, managing customer expectations and communications to a resolution of such incidents. As a Technical Account Manager, you will work closely with our Engineering, Product Management, and Global Support teams to debug, test, and resolve issues. You'll need to be able to work as part of a team, enjoy working hard, and be professional and dedicated to meeting and exceeding expectations and building relationships. You'll also need to have excellent communication, collaboration skills, and the ability to learn new technologies quickly and use your time efficiently.
What You Will Do:
Support customers in Day-2 operations as they deploy automated, containerized applications on a hybrid cloud platform.
Manage and grow customer relationships by delivering attentive, relationship-based support
Build a sense of trust with customers and serve as their advocate within Red Hat
Perform technical reviews and share knowledge to identify and prevent issues
Gain an understanding of customer technical infrastructures and environments, hardware, and offerings
Create customer engagement plans and keep the documentation on customer environments updated
Participate in issues and act as an advocate for customers during the triage and resolution of high-severity cases, driving business reliability and customer satisfaction
Perform initial or secondary investigations and respond to online and phone support requests
Partner closely with Red Hat's engineering, product management, and technical support teams to debug, test, and resolve issues
Regularly contribute to the Red Hat knowledge base and share best practices with peers and colleagues
Engage with Red Hat's solutions engineering teams to help develop solution patterns based on customer engagements as well as personal experience that will guide platform adoption
Engage with Red Hat's field teams, customers, and partners to ensure a positive cloud technology experience and a successful outcome resulting in long-term enterprise success
Communicate how specific Red Hat’s cloud solutions and our cloud roadmap align with customer use cases
Travel, as necessary, to visit customers and attend events within the country or region
What You Will Bring
Solid skills and background in Red Hat OpenShift or a similar Kubernetes distribution
Experience in system installation, configuration, upgrading, and maintenance of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) or other Linux distributions
Strong analytical capabilities combined with proficiency in debugging and troubleshooting in technical environments
Ability to manage and grow existing enterprise customer relationships by delivering proactive, relationship-based support
Outstanding written and verbal communication skills; ability to convey complex information to customers clearly and concisely
Competent comprehension of enterprise architecture and strategic business drivers
Ability to manage multiple issues and projects with a focus on detail
Aptitude to learn new open source technologies quickly
The Following Are Considered a Plus
Bachelor's degree in a technology-related discipline, preferably computer science or engineering
Experience working in a Technical Account Management, Product Support, DevOps, or Engineering role
Software engineering background; experience with RPM-based Linux and Java technologies
Experience developing code at scale on source control structures
Experience with agile software methodologies, including test-based development, test planning, test case design, test script automation, and documentation
Experience deploying applications in cloud environments
Experience in developing and managing containerized applications
Good grasp of CI/CD concepts
Upstream involvement in open source projects

About Red Hat
Red Hat is the world’s leading provider of enterprise open source software solutions, using a community-powered approach to deliver high-performing Linux, cloud, container, and Kubernetes technologies. Spread across 40+ countries, our associates work flexibly across work environments, from in-office, to office-flex, to fully remote, depending on the requirements of their role. Red Hatters are encouraged to bring their best ideas, no matter their title or tenure. We're a leader in open source because of our open and inclusive environment. We hire creative, passionate people ready to contribute their ideas, help solve complex problems, and make an impact.
